Respirator programs that utilize positive-pressure systems with loose-fitting helmets and hoods are easier to administer, according to Jerry Guilliams, a Boeing Co. senior commercial hygienist and security specialist. These kinds of respirators, he explained, do not need fit screening, and users need not be clean-shaven. "Right there, you have actually gotten rid of two substantial aspects of employee resistance," stated Guilliams, who works for Boeing's Military Airplane and Missile Systems Group in St. Louis.
Quality Paint Task at Piper Aircraft
New Piper Airplane Inc. manufactures single-engine aircrafts for private, business and flight school use. At its 1,200-employee center in Vero Beach, Fla., New Piper Aircraft operates an advanced paint shop for using multiple coats of paint on the airplanes. It is a demanding, high-precision task. To protect employees from paint overspray, the business had actually been utilizing full-face, negative-pressure respirators. Sadly, paint overspray and incompatibility with prescription glasses were affecting employees' clear vision, which was harming the quality of the paint task.

The service was to change to a supplied-air respirator with a loose-fitting helmet and Article source a peel-off face shield, which secures the primary lens and can be changed when vision becomes blocked by paint spray. The business also utilizes 3M's Vortex cooling system, which enables staff members to manage the temperature of their breathing air by cooling it as much as 50 degrees-- an important health safety measure and convenience benefit in hot, damp Florida.

" This is the very best thing we've performed in years," stated Dave Youmans, safety planner at the Piper Aircraft plant. "There is definitely no trade-off among production, defense and comfort. We discovered a solution that is easy for management, staff members, and safety and health individuals to support. We don't need to require this issue at all due to the fact that the quality issues are so essential. At Piper, the paint store supervisor pushed for this option, and the director of manufacturing spent for it out of his budget."

The success in the paint shop has actually led to the maintenance department's interest in supplied-air respirators. Regardless of the short-term, scattered nature of maintenance work, Youmans said, a supplied-air program can be made practical for maintenance workers by stationing high-pressure, supplied-air sources throughout the plant.
